gir-repository r52 - in trunk: . gir



Author: johan
Date: Thu Aug 21 20:31:59 2008
New Revision: 52
URL: http://svn.gnome.org/viewvc/gir-repository?rev=52&view=rev

Log:
2008-08-21  Johan Dahlin  <johan gnome org>

    * gir/JSCore.gir:
    * gir/Makefile.am:
    Add manually written JSCore and scan WebKit



Added:
   trunk/gir/JSCore.gir
Modified:
   trunk/ChangeLog
   trunk/gir/Makefile.am

Added: trunk/gir/JSCore.gir
==============================================================================
--- (empty file)
+++ trunk/gir/JSCore.gir	Thu Aug 21 20:31:59 2008
@@ -0,0 +1,17 @@
+<repository version="1.0"
+            xmlns="http://www.gtk.org/introspection/core/1.0";
+            xmlns:c="http://www.gtk.org/introspection/c/1.0";>
+  <namespace name="JSCore" shared-library="webkit-1.0">
+    <alias name="GlobalContextRef"
+           target="none"
+           c:type="JSGlobalContextRef"/>
+    <alias name="ObjectRef" target="none" c:type="JSObjectRef"/>
+    <function name="EvaluateScript" c:identifier="JSEvaluateScript">
+      <return-value>
+        <type name="none" c:type="void"/>
+      </return-value>
+      <parameters>
+      </parameters>
+    </function>
+  </namespace>
+</repository>

Modified: trunk/gir/Makefile.am
==============================================================================
--- trunk/gir/Makefile.am	(original)
+++ trunk/gir/Makefile.am	Thu Aug 21 20:31:59 2008
@@ -6,7 +6,7 @@
 # pango
 PANGO_INCLUDEDIR=`pkg-config --variable=includedir pango`/pango-1.0
 PANGO_LIBDIR=`pkg-config --variable=libdir pango`
-Pango.gir: Makefile $(G_IR_SCANNER)
+Pango.gir: $(G_IR_SCANNER)
 	$(G_IR_SCANNER) -v --namespace Pango \
             --include=$(GIRDIR)/GLib.gir \
             --include=$(GIRDIR)/GObject.gir \
@@ -22,7 +22,7 @@
 BUILT_GIRSOURCES += Pango.gir
 
 PANGOFT2_LIBDIR=`pkg-config --variable=libdir pangoft2`
-PangoFT2.gir: fontconfig.gir freetype2.gir Pango.gir Makefile $(G_IR_SCANNER)
+PangoFT2.gir: fontconfig.gir freetype2.gir Pango.gir $(G_IR_SCANNER)
 	$(G_IR_SCANNER) -v --namespace PangoFT2 \
             --include=$(GIRDIR)/GLib.gir \
             --include=$(GIRDIR)/GObject.gir \
@@ -41,7 +41,7 @@
 BUILT_GIRSOURCES += PangoFT2.gir
 
 PANGOCAIRO_LIBDIR=`pkg-config --variable=libdir pangocairo`
-PangoCairo.gir: cairo.gir Pango.gir Makefile $(G_IR_SCANNER)
+PangoCairo.gir: cairo.gir Pango.gir $(G_IR_SCANNER)
 	$(G_IR_SCANNER) -v --namespace PangoCairo \
             --include=$(GIRDIR)/GLib.gir \
             --include=$(GIRDIR)/GObject.gir \
@@ -58,7 +58,7 @@
 BUILT_GIRSOURCES += PangoCairo.gir
 
 PANGOXFT_LIBDIR=`pkg-config --variable=libdir pangoxft`
-PangoXft.gir: fontconfig.gir xft.gir xlib.gir Pango.gir PangoFT2.gir Makefile $(G_IR_SCANNER)
+PangoXft.gir: fontconfig.gir xft.gir xlib.gir Pango.gir PangoFT2.gir $(G_IR_SCANNER)
 	$(G_IR_SCANNER) -v --namespace PangoXft \
             --include=$(GIRDIR)/GLib.gir \
             --include=$(GIRDIR)/GObject.gir \
@@ -79,7 +79,7 @@
 BUILT_GIRSOURCES += PangoXft.gir
 
 PANGOX_LIBDIR=`pkg-config --variable=libdir pangox`
-PangoX.gir: xlib.gir Pango.gir Makefile $(G_IR_SCANNER)
+PangoX.gir: xlib.gir Pango.gir $(G_IR_SCANNER)
 	$(G_IR_SCANNER) -v --namespace PangoX \
             --include=$(GIRDIR)/GLib.gir \
             --include=$(GIRDIR)/GObject.gir \
@@ -98,7 +98,7 @@
 # atk
 ATK_INCLUDEDIR=`pkg-config --variable=includedir atk`/atk-1.0
 ATK_LIBDIR=`pkg-config --variable=libdir atk`
-Atk.gir: Makefile $(G_IR_SCANNER)
+Atk.gir: $(G_IR_SCANNER)
 	$(G_IR_SCANNER) -v --namespace Atk \
              --include=$(GIRDIR)/GLib.gir \
              --include=$(GIRDIR)/GObject.gir \
@@ -113,7 +113,7 @@
 # gdk
 GDKPIXBUF_INCLUDEDIR=`pkg-config --variable=includedir gdk-pixbuf-2.0`/gtk-2.0
 GDKPIXBUF_LIBDIR=`pkg-config --variable=libdir gdk-pixbuf-2.0`
-GdkPixbuf.gir: Makefile $(G_IR_SCANNER)
+GdkPixbuf.gir: $(G_IR_SCANNER)
 	$(G_IR_SCANNER) -v --namespace GdkPixbuf --strip-prefix=Gdk \
              --include=$(GIRDIR)/GLib.gir \
              --include=$(GIRDIR)/GObject.gir \
@@ -129,7 +129,7 @@
 
 GDK_INCLUDEDIR=`pkg-config --variable=includedir gdk-2.0`/gtk-2.0
 GDK_LIBDIR=`pkg-config --variable=libdir gdk-2.0`
-Gdk.gir: cairo.gir Pango.gir xlib.gir GdkPixbuf.gir Makefile $(G_IR_SCANNER)
+Gdk.gir: cairo.gir Pango.gir xlib.gir GdkPixbuf.gir $(G_IR_SCANNER)
 	$(G_IR_SCANNER) -v --namespace Gdk \
              --include=$(GIRDIR)/GLib.gir \
              --include=$(GIRDIR)/GObject.gir \
@@ -155,7 +155,7 @@
 # gtk
 GTK_INCLUDEDIR=`pkg-config --variable=includedir gtk+-2.0`/gtk-2.0
 GTK_LIBDIR=`pkg-config --variable=libdir gtk+-2.0`
-Gtk.gir: cairo.gir Pango.gir Atk.gir xlib.gir GdkPixbuf.gir Gdk.gir Makefile $(G_IR_SCANNER)
+Gtk.gir: cairo.gir Pango.gir Atk.gir xlib.gir GdkPixbuf.gir Gdk.gir $(G_IR_SCANNER)
 	$(G_IR_SCANNER) -v --namespace Gtk \
              --include=$(GIRDIR)/GLib.gir \
              --include=$(GIRDIR)/GObject.gir \
@@ -183,6 +183,27 @@
              $(GTK_INCLUDEDIR)/gtk/*.h
 BUILT_GIRSOURCES += Gtk.gir
 
+# webkit
+
+WEBKIT_INCLUDEDIR=`pkg-config --variable=includedir webkit-1.0`
+WEBKIT_LIBDIR=`pkg-config --variable=libdir webkit-1.0`
+WebKit.gir: JSCore.gir Gtk.gir $(G_IR_SCANNER)
+	$(G_IR_SCANNER) -v --namespace WebKit \
+             --include=$(GIRDIR)/GLib.gir \
+             --include=$(GIRDIR)/GObject.gir \
+             --include=$(srcdir)/Gtk.gir \
+             --include=$(srcdir)/JSCore.gir \
+	     --library=webkit-1.0 \
+	     $(NOCLOSURE) \
+             --pkg gobject-2.0 \
+             --pkg gtk+-2.0 \
+             --pkg webkit-1.0 \
+             --output $@ \
+	     -I$(WEBKIT_INCLUDEDIR) \
+             $(WEBKIT_INCLUDEDIR)/webkit-1.0/webkit/*.h
+BUILT_GIRSOURCES += WebKit.gir
+CUSTOM_GIRSOURCES += JSCore.gir
+
 girdir = $(datadir)/gir
 dist_gir_DATA = $(CUSTOM_GIRSOURCES) $(BUILT_GIRSOURCES)
 



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]